Jesus – Sinners: In today’s Gospel, Jesus not only dined with public sinners; He also called one of them, Matthew to be His apostle.  Ponder on, “Are we self-righteous towards those who have ‘sinful behaviours’?  Is Jesus inviting us to be less judgmental and be more compassionate as we are sinners ourselves?”

Mark 2:13-17

Jesus went out to the shore of the lake; and all the people came to him, and he taught them. As he was walking along he saw Levi the son of Alphaeus sitting at the customs house, and he said to him, ‘Follow me.’ And he got up and followed him.

When Jesus was at dinner in his house, a number of tax collectors and sinners were also sitting at table with Jesus and his disciples; for there were many of them among his followers. When the scribes of the Pharisee party saw him eating with sinners and tax collectors, they said to his disciples, ‘Why does he eat with tax collectors and sinners?’

When Jesus heard this he said to them, ‘It is not the healthy who need the doctor, but the sick. I did not come to call the virtuous, but sinners.’
